Tech companies are turning to HBCUs to host AI data centers

Big Tech is looking for land to build its AI data centers. HBCUs are looking for new funding after federal cuts.


And partnerships between them, like one announced by Fisk University, could be a mutually beneficial — or could end up being a form of "digital sharecropping," according to strategist Ashley Northington, who wrote about this for Tech Policy Press.
